Well within RF's recommended sealed enclosure range for the P3D2-15.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003c\/div\u003e\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n  \u003cdiv class=\"po-section\"\u003e\n    \u003ch2\u003eWhy This Box Is Tuned Larger Than RF's \"Optimum\" Spec\u003c\/h2\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eThis is where the Performance Optimized name earns its keep. RF's published 1.58 cu ft sealed optimum for the P3D2-15 targets a system Qtc close to 1.0 — an alignment that delivers peak SPL output efficiency in a modest cabinet footprint. It's a valid design target, but it's not the only one.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eSystem Qtc (total Q of the driver + enclosure system) determines the shape of the sealed alignment's response. Higher Qtc = more peak output at the resonance frequency, sharper rolloff below, less transient accuracy, and a \"punchier\" but less refined presentation. Lower Qtc = smoother rolloff, better transient response, deeper F3, and a more musically accurate presentation with better stereo imaging in the low bass region.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003cdiv class=\"po-grid\"\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"po-card\"\u003e\n        \u003ch4\u003eRF's Spec (Qtc ≈ 1.0)\u003c\/h4\u003e\n        \u003cp\u003e1.58 cu ft net. Optimized for peak output in a compact cabinet. Peak hump around Fc gives a \"loud\" impression at moderate power. Sharper below-cutoff rolloff. Better fits SPL-oriented builds and demo situations where headline output matters more than musical accuracy.\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003c\/div\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"po-card\"\u003e\n        \u003ch4\u003ePO Wedge Tune (Qtc ≈ 0.85)\u003c\/h4\u003e\n        \u003cp\u003e1.75 cu ft net. Optimized for musical accuracy and daily-driver satisfaction. Flatter response through the peak region, better transient recovery, slightly deeper F3, better integration with midbass. Fits SQ-oriented builds and full-range systems where the sub needs to blend, not dominate.\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eBoth alignments are within RF's stated sealed range for the P3D2-15. The 11% cabinet size difference is deliberate and modest — enough to shift the Q meaningfully, not enough to leave the driver's designed operating envelope. If you want peak SPL and don't care about musical accuracy, RF's 1.58 spec is right for you (and we can build to that spec on request). If you want the P3D2-15 to sound its musical best in a daily-driven vehicle, this is the box.\u003c\/p\u003e\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n  \u003cdiv class=\"po-section\"\u003e\n    \u003ch2\u003eTrunk-Load Wedge Design Explained\u003c\/h2\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eThis wedge is not a front-firing enclosure. The woofer is mounted on the vertical face that sits at the back of the box, closest to the trunk lid, and fires rearward into the trunk cavity. The angled face is on the opposite side of the box — the side that faces the front of the vehicle — and tucks against the rear seat back. Two different problems solved by one geometry.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003cdiv class=\"po-grid\"\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"po-card\"\u003e\n        \u003ch4\u003eSeat-Side Face Matches Seat Lean\u003c\/h4\u003e\n        \u003cp\u003eMost factory rear seat backs lean roughly 20 degrees back from vertical. The angled face of this wedge (8.6\" at the top, 15.2\" at the bottom) matches that lean, tucking against the seat back with no wasted gap. The P3's shallower 7.58\" mounting depth allows a lower-profile top face than the T1 15\" wedge, making this cabinet more fittable in vehicles with tighter parcel-shelf clearance.\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003c\/div\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"po-card\"\u003e\n        \u003ch4\u003eTrunk-Lid-Side Face Fires the Woofer\u003c\/h4\u003e\n        \u003cp\u003eThe vertical face on the opposite side of the wedge (26.25\" wide × 18\" tall) is where the P3D2-15 mounts. The driver fires rearward toward the trunk lid, using the trunk cavity as an acoustic loading chamber. Classic SQ trunk-load install pattern applied to Rockford's most musical 15\" driver.\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003c\/div\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"po-card\"\u003e\n        \u003ch4\u003eTrunk Cavity Loading\u003c\/h4\u003e\n        \u003cp\u003eFiring the woofer into the trunk cavity rather than directly into the cabin uses the trunk itself as an extension of the acoustic system. Low frequencies transmit into the passenger cabin through the rear deck, seat back, and cabin boundaries — a smoother, less-localized presentation than direct-firing setups. Pairs especially well with the P3's already-musical character.\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003c\/div\u003e\n      \u003cdiv class=\"po-card\"\u003e\n        \u003ch4\u003eVehicle Sizing Requirements\u003c\/h4\u003e\n        \u003cp\u003e26.25\" wide by 18\" tall by 8.6-15.2\" deep. Requires a full-size sedan trunk, wagon or SUV cargo area, or pickup extended-cab or crew-cab install with adequate behind-seat space. The 18\" height is critical for parcel shelf clearance — measure carefully before ordering. Substantially more trunk-friendly than the T1D215 wedge but still requires real cargo space.\u003c\/p\u003e\n      \u003c\/div\u003e\n    \u003c\/div\u003e\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n  \u003cdiv class=\"po-section\"\u003e\n    \u003ch2\u003eDriver Fitment and Mounting Geometry\u003c\/h2\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eThe vertical trunk-lid-side baffle is cut to the P3D2-15's exact 13.94\" cutout specification. Source your driver from any authorized Rockford Fosgate dealer.\u003c\/p\u003e\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n  \u003cdiv class=\"po-section\"\u003e\n    \u003ch2\u003eWiring the Rockford Fosgate P3D2-15 to Your Amplifier\u003c\/h2\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eThe Rockford Fosgate P3D2-15 is a dual-voice-coil driver with both coils at 2 ohms, using RF's 10-AWG nickel-plated push terminals for direct wire attachment. The pre-wired terminal cup accepts the two-conductor connection via 12-gauge OFC, with stainless steel input hardware.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eParallel wiring (1 ohm total load):\u003c\/strong\u003e Both voice coils wired in parallel presents a 1-ohm load to your amplifier — the highest-output configuration, ideal for RF's own Punch P600X1 or Prime R500X1D monoblock amplifiers, or any modern class D monoblock stable at 1 ohm. This is the standard high-output wiring configuration for a single-driver P3 install.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eSeries wiring (4 ohm total load):\u003c\/strong\u003e Both voice coils wired in series presents a 4-ohm load — used with amplifiers that don't support 1-ohm stable operation, or in dual-driver installs where paralleling two 4-ohm loads at the amp gets you back to a 2-ohm total. Also compatible with class AB amplifiers preferring higher impedance loads.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eP3D4-15 alternative:\u003c\/strong\u003e Rockford also offers the P3D4-15 (Dual 4-ohm) variant for installs where 2-ohm parallel or 8-ohm series operation is preferred. Either variant fits this cabinet identically.\u003c\/p\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eThe P3D2-15 is rated for 600 watts RMS continuous (CEA-2031 compliant) with 1200W peak handling. Aim for a well-regulated class D monoblock delivering 400-600 watts RMS at your chosen impedance for the best combination of headroom and dynamic capability. Rockford Fosgate's own Punch P600X1 monoblock is a natural match. Set your amplifier's active low-pass filter between 80 and 100 Hz for musical accuracy in a full-range system.\u003c\/p\u003e\n  \u003c\/div\u003e\n\n  \u003cdiv class=\"po-section\"\u003e\n    \u003ch2\u003eBuilt in Tennessee, Backed by Audio Intensity\u003c\/h2\u003e\n    \u003cp\u003eEvery Performance Optimized enclosure is CNC-cut, assembled, and finished in our Tullahoma, TN facility.
